Once you have got the gutters, soffits and facia cleaned (which works out expensive for the custy)I wonder if the customer would be prepared to pay a higher premium for the return of keeping them clean all year round? They are so easy to whip over say every other time (ten weeks) than doing a full back breaking, neck straining clean. Does anyone do it? This is outside gutter cleaning i'm talking here.
-
What i meant was instead of a house being a £15 clean every five weeks maybe make it a £20 clean or £25 to keep the whole outside spick and span. If i screw on a small brush i can easily walk it down the length of a gutter in a couple of minutes provided it's not 'minging' same with soffits and facias.
